BPDA2
T735522907659-86-1In house
BPDA2 is a highly selective and competitive SHP2 inhibitor, exhibiting IC50 values of 92.0 nM for SHP2, and 33.39 μM and 40.71 μM for SHP1 and SHP1B, respectively. This compound effectively downregulates mitogenic and cell survival signaling, including reducing expression of receptor tyrosine kinases (RTKs). Furthermore, BPDA2 suppresses SHP2-mediated signaling, leading to the inhibition of breast cancer cell phenotypes [1].

Tacrolimus monohydrate
Tacrolimus hydrate, Prograf, LCP-Tacro, FR900506, FR 900506, FK-506, FK 506
T20879109581-93-3
Tacrolimus monohydrate (LCP-Tacro) is a macrolide from the culture broth of a strain of Streptomyces tsukubaensis, binds to FK506 binding protein (FKBP) to form a complex. Tacrolimus inhibits calcineurin phosphatase, which inhibits T-lymphocyte signal transduction and IL-2 transcription. Immunosuppressive properties. It prevents the activation of T-lymphocytes in response to antigenic or mitogenic stimulation in vitro and has strong immunosuppressive activity in vivo.

Reveromycin A
T37008134615-37-5
Reveromycin A is the major component of a complex of spiroketal antibiotics isolated from Streptomyces sp. It inhibits the mitogenic activity of epidermal growth factor in Balb MK cells (IC50 = 0.7 μg ml), displays antiproliferative activity against human KB and K562 tumor cell lines (IC50s = 1.9 and 1.6 μg ml, respectively), and demonstrates antifungal activity against C. albicans (MIC = 2 μg ml at pH 3). Reveromycin A also has been shown to inhibit bone resorption by inducing apoptosis in osteoclasts with an IC50 value of 0.7 μM.

Tetranactin
T3705233956-61-5
Tetranactin is a macrotetrolide and a monovalent cation ionophore that has been found in S. aureus and has antibacterial, insecticidal, and mitogenic activities. It exhibits an equilibrium permeability ratio 1,000-fold greater for lithium than sodium or cesium ions accross bilayer membranes at low voltages. Tetranactin inhibits the growth of Gram-positive bacteria and C. miyabeanus and R. solani fungi when used at concentrations less than 0.9 μg/ml. Tetranactin (0.5-1.5 μg per insect) dose-dependently increases the mortality of adult C. chinensis weevils up to 100% and has mitogenic activity against T. telarius when sprayed onto plants with an LC50 value of 9.2 μg/ml. It reduces IL-1β- and cAMP-induced secretion of phospholipase A2 (PLA2) from rat mesangial cells (IC50s = 43 and 33 nM, respectively). Tetranactin (50 ng/ml) suppresses the proliferation of human T lymphocytes induced by allogeneic cells and IL-2 and supresses the generation of cytotoxic T lymphocytes in mixed lymphocyte cultures. In vivo, tetranactin (10 mg/animal per day) completely inhibits the formation of experimental autoimmune uveoretinitis (EAU) in rats.

Reveromycin D
T37423144860-70-8
Reveromycin D is a bacterial metabolite originally isolated from Streptomyces. It inhibits EGF-induced mitogenic activity in Balb MK cells and exhibits pH-dependent antifungal activity against C. albicans [MICs = 2 and >500 μg ml at pH 3 and 7.4, respectively]. Reveromycin D also inhibits the proliferation of KB and K562 cells [IC50s = 1.6 and 1.3 μg ml, respectively].

Reveromycin B
T38044144860-68-4
Reveromycin B is a spiroketal bacterial metabolite originally isolated from Streptomyces. It inhibits EGF-induced mitogenic activity in Balb MK cells (IC50 = 6 μg ml) and exhibits pH-dependent antifungal activity against C. albicans [MICs = 15.6 and >500 μg ml at pH 3.0 and 7.4, respectively]. Unlike reveromycin A and reveromycin C, reveromycin B does not inhibit the proliferation of KB and K562 cells.

Myelopeptide-2
T76379137833-31-9
Myelopeptide-2, a peptide isolated from the supernatant of porcine bone marrow cell cultures, can restore the mitogenic reactivity of human T lymphocytes inhibited by HL-60 leukemia cells or measles virus conditions. It also enhances depressed interleukin-2 (IL-2) synthesis and interleukin-2 receptor (IL-2R) expression, playing a role in immunity homeostasis. This compound shows potential for application in antitumor and antivirus research [1] [2].
